3D Printing in Dental Surgery
To enhance the field of oral surgery, you can check out the subtopic of 3D printing in dental surgery. This ingenious innovation has the prospective to reinvent the means dental specialists operate and deal with individuals. Here are 4 key ways in which 3D printing is forming the field:
- ** Customized Surgical Guides **: 3D printing permits the production of highly exact and patient-specific medical guides, improving the accuracy and effectiveness of treatments.
- ** Implant Prosthetics **: With 3D printing, dental doctors can create customized dental implant prosthetics that completely fit a patient's one-of-a-kind composition, resulting in better results and individual contentment.
- ** Bone Grafting **: 3D printing allows the manufacturing of patient-specific bone grafts, lowering the need for standard grafting methods and improving healing and healing time.
- ** Education and learning and Training **: 3D printing can be utilized to develop practical medical models for instructional functions, enabling dental doctors to practice complex treatments prior to executing them on people.
With its possible to enhance precision, customization, and training, 3D printing is an exciting growth in the field of oral surgery.
Minimally Intrusive Methods
To even more advance the area of oral surgery, welcome the potential of minimally intrusive techniques that can significantly benefit both specialists and individuals alike.
Minimally invasive methods are changing the field by minimizing medical injury, reducing post-operative discomfort, and increasing the healing process. These strategies include utilizing smaller sized lacerations and specialized instruments to execute procedures with accuracy and efficiency.

Furthermore, the use of lasers in oral surgery enables specific tissue cutting and coagulation, causing reduced bleeding and minimized recovery time.
With minimally invasive strategies, patients can experience much faster healing, reduced scarring, and enhanced results, making it an essential element of the future of dental surgery.
